Here’s the Thing: How Do You Find Out the Voltage?

When it comes down to identifying the voltage of overhead power lines, the best avenue is to contact the power company. That’s right! If you think you can check the voltage gauge on your forklift, you might want to think again. Forklift gauges aren’t equipped to tell you what’s happening miles above your head. They are designed for measuring the system within the machinery itself, not for assessing external electrical hazards.

Furthermore, while you might spot a flashy warning sign nearby or try to gauge the distance from the ground to the line, let's face it: these methods just don’t cut it. Warning signs may advise you about the potential risks, but they seldom include specifics about voltage levels. And measuring height? That’s like trying to guess the weight of your friend by looking at their shadow—it’s a hit or miss.

But What About Those Signs and Gauges?

If we’re being honest, there’s nothing wrong with wanting to play it safe. After all, being vigilant is a smart move when operating heavy machinery. But let’s explore why some of these alternative methods can lead to risky assumptions.

  1. Voltage Gauges on Forklifts: These gauges measure the machinery’s own electrical systems while completely ignoring what's overhead. Relying on them to gauge external lines? Nah, it’s like using a compass in a dark room—totally misleading.

  2. Warning Signs: Sure, they have an important purpose. They alert and advise. Telling someone to stay clear because of possible electrical hazards is great, but if they don’t offer specifics on voltage? Not as helpful as you’d hope.

  3. Height Measuring: Judging the distance between the ground and lines may provide a loose concept of safety but doesn't reveal anything about the power flowing through those lines. Think of it this way: just because you can reach the top shelf, doesn’t mean what’s up there isn’t dangerous.
